Web6 sep. 2011 · Heterosporic plants produce small spores called microspores which either germinate to become male gametophytes or have reduced male gametophytes … WebFern gametophytes, often called prothalli (singular, prothallus) are one cell layer thick except in the centre. Most fern prothalli are bisexual--i.e., have both male (antheridia) and female (archegonia)sex organs, which develop usually on the undersurface of the prothallus.

Web3 Department of Experimental Plant Biology, Faculty of Science, Charles University in Prague, Viničná 5, 128 44, Prague 2, Czech Republic. david@ueb ... pollen tube … WebMoss sperm are motile and capable of swimming short distances to fertilize an egg. However, it was unknown until recently how sperm make their way from male to female gametophytes that may be separated by a distance of several centimeters or more.
